Kenny’s Farmhouse Cheese has issued a second recall for some of its products due to possible listeria contamination.

The Courier Journal reports the recall was made by the Austin, Kentucky, company Monday after routine testing of certain cheese samples found listeria monocytogenes, which can sicken vulnerable people.

The types of cheese include chipotle colby, colby, monterey jack and mild cheddar sold or distributed in Kentucky, Tennessee, Indiana, North Carolina, Alabama and Virginia, according to the report. The products went to restaurants, farmer markets and distributors beginning September 2.
